An Irish actor and father who relocates his family to New York City. He struggles with grief over his son Frankie's death, which initially leaves him emotionally detached. Despite financial hardships, he works as a cab driver, reconciles with his wife, supports their premature baby's blood transfusion, and eventually overcomes his emotional block to secure a Broadway role.
